American Airlines launches grab-and-go lounge at New York’s JFK Airport

American Airlines is set to introduce a new grab-and-go lounge at New York’s John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K) by the end of this year, marking its first significant addition to the airport in over four years. This initiative is part of the airline’s strategy to attract premium customers and address widening profit disparities with major competitors such as Delta Air Lines and United Airlines.

This new lounge, spanning 3,700 square feet, will feature a barista bar offering a variety of hot and cold coffee drinks, alongside a selection of grab-and-go food items. The growing trend of such short-visit lounges is indicative of airlines’ efforts to cater to frequent travelers who often prefer quick and convenient experiences without the crowding associated with traditional airport clubs. United Airlines, for example, opened its first similar facility at Denver International Airport in late 2022, signaling a clear shift in the hospitality approach within the airline industry.

In recent years, airlines and credit card companies have elevated entry requirements for their lounge facilities while scaling back complimentary perks such as guest passes. This strategy aims to alleviate congestion in these exclusive spaces, thereby enhancing the overall experience for high-paying customers. American Airlines has already launched its Provisions grab-and-go concept at Charlotte Douglas International Airport, and the upcoming JFK facility is expected to replicate that successful model.

Operating out of JFK’s Terminal 8, which is shared with partners from the Oneworld Alliance, American Airlines maintains a number of high-end lounges designed for business and first-class travelers. These exclusive areas were last updated in 2022, and while American has invested in improving lounges in cities like Chicago and Austin, the enhancement at JFK signifies a renewed focus on elevating customer experience in one of the nation’s busiest airports.
